Girdner is an unincorporated community in Douglas County, in the U.S. state of Missouri. [1] Girdner is located in central Douglas County, southeast of Ava, on Missouri Route P and the north side of Rippee Creek, a tributary of Bryant Creek. [2]
A post office called Girdner was established in 1885, and remained in operation until 1942. [3] The community has the name of "Doc" Girdner, a pioneer citizen. [4]
